The concert, which took place at the famed New York hall on November 29, 1957, was preserved on newly-discovered tapes made by Voice of America for a later radio broadcast that were located at the Library of Congress in Washington DC earlier this year. Monkand Coltranehad been working together for a solid four months by the time they set foot on stage at Carnegie Hall that night. By all accounts, Coltrane had been tentative early on in the Five Spot run, challenged at first by Monk¿s quirky melodies and chord changes, but the 51 minutes of music captured in pristine sound quality on At Carnegie Hall, present the quartet, which was completed by bassist Ahmed Abdul-Malikand drummer Shadow Wilson, at the height of their powers.The tapes from that evening at Carnegie Hall were inadequately labeled, filed away amongst the Voice of America¿s vast collection of recordings, and apparently forgotten until January 2005 when Larry Applebaum, a supervisor and jazz specialist at the Library of Congress, came upon them by accident during the routine process of digitally transferring the Library¿s collection for preservation purposes. Applebaum noticed a set of tapes simply labeled ¿sp. Event 11/29/57 carnegie jazz concert (#1),¿ with one of the tapes barring the sole marking ¿T. Monk.¿ Until now, remarkably little recorded documentation of Monk¿s quartet with Coltrane has been known to exist, a fact that makes this finding all the more significant. Charted at No. 1 on Billboard's Pop Music chart in 1958.Frank Sinatra Sings For Only The Lonely is one of five melancholy collections recorded for Capitol consisting of saloon songs and bluesy ballads, lamenting lost love and heartache. Recorded over three days in Capitol's Studio B, it features sumptuous arrangements all around by Nelson Riddle, who also co-conducts with Sinatra's resident concertmaster Felix Slatkin. Tour de force versions of What's New, Blues In The Night, Spring Is Here, One For My Baby, Guess I'll Hang My Tears Out To Dry and Good-Bye all became Sinatra's personal property for the ages. It is believed to be the first significant double album in rock music, its length forcing it to two LPs, although some digital reissues fit the album on one compact disc. It is notable for injecting Dylan's brand of blues rock, fully established on Highway 61 Revisited, with a more eclectic sound and even more surreal lyrics. Despite its uncompromising nature, it has come to be regarded as one of Dylan's greatest achievements, and "one of the greatest rock & roll albums ever made". Ellington, in speaking of the band's competitive nature, recalled that they were all in a particularly fesity mode for this performance. That crackling energy translates to every number, and even extended to Count Basie's original drummer Jo Jones, who sat grinning from ear to ear in the front row, so moved by the swing of it all that he beat time for the band with a rolled up copy of The Christian Science Monitor. From Johnny Hodges' ultra-suave "Jeep's Blues", to Paul Gonsalves' epic tenor marathon on "Diminuendo And Crescendo In Blue" (which set the crowd to dancing and screaming), ELLINGTON AT NEWPORT is one of the really great big band recordings. 'Panama 500' finds him with two different groups of musicians who perform Perez's own compositions that celebrate the 500th anniversary of the historic crossing, in 1513, of the Panama isthmus by explorer Vasco Nunez de Balboa. Perez finds musical interpretation and inspiration for his compositions in two groups of players - one featuring bassist John Patitucci and drummer Brian Blade, fellow musicians in Shorter's quartet, with contributions from percussionist Rogerio Boccato and cellist Sachi Patitucci. The other group features drummer Adam Cruz, bassist Ben Street, violinist Alex Hargreaves and percussionist Roman Diaz. Both groups are musical allies and stunning collaborators in Danilo's vision. The music is a multi-cultural mix of jazz, Latin American folk, classical music and blues with Middle Eastern and Asian sounds in the mix. In addition three tracks include music and narration from the Guna indigenous people of Panama. Besides the obvious abilities of the leader, most notable here is a still very young Lee Morgan on trumpet. The jubilant Morgan, at this time a rising star yet to hit his stride, makes an exquisite partner for the bluesy Mobley, one of the most underrated tenor men in jazz. Rounding out the quintet is the rhythm section of pianist Wynton Kelly, bassist Paul Chambers, and the often-overlooked drummer Charlie Persip. As the title suggests, PECKIN' has the spirit of a blowing session with a hefty amount of up-tempo rousers. The bopping opener "High and Flighty" gets things kicking with frenzied ensemble work and hard-blowing solos. The only standard of the set is the classic "Speak Low," here presented as a bouncing rhumba with exceptionally lyrical contributions by Morgan. The swinging title track and the aptly titled burner "Stretchin' Out" both offer more opportunities for all to display their wares with plenty of hard bop gusto. Finally, "Git-Go Blues" closes the session with a long, rolling groove that swings hard and deep. Also included are three alternate takes that offer even more blowing and swinging.
